(a)In lieu of subdivisions (b), (c), (d), (e), and (f) of Section 22314, with respect to open-end loans, a licensee may provide credit insurance with the borrower’s consent, in a form to be approved by the Insurance Commissioner, in an amount not in excess of the amount of the indebtedness. For credit life or disability insurance, the licensee may collect from the borrower an amount established pursuant to Section 779.36 of the Insurance Code.
(b)If life insurance is
provided, and if the insured borrower dies during the term of the loan contract, the insurance shall be sufficient to pay the total amount due on the loan outstanding on the date of his or her death, without any exception, reservation, or limitation.
